"Obituary. The funeral of Dennis Hickey, one of the oldest residents of this city, who died at his residence, 103 South Fifth Street, Saturday, of old age, took place this afternoon to Mt. Carmel Cemetary [sic]. The deceased was known and esteemed and leaves a widow and large family of children, most of whom are grown, to mourn their loss. The deceased was 73 years of age, and the remains were were followed to-day to their last resting place by a very large [illegible] of sorrowing relatives and friends." -The East St. Louis Daily Journal, Nov. 12, 1894; p.__. --------
"The funeral of the late Dennis Hickey was largely attended yesterday afternoon from St. Mary's Roman Catholic church on Converse avenue to Mount Carmel cemetery. The pall-bearers were Bartholomew Long, John Dowd, Dave Roche, Thomas Connoly, John Griffin and A. Burns. A number of friends from abroad attended the funeral, among them was ex-City Clerk Canty, who now resides in St. Louis." -The East St. Louis Daily Journal, Nov. 13, 1894; p. 3, col.2
